The Sursiks specialize in turning non-musical material into music. Their debut cd "I didn't know i was singing, vol. 1" consists of 16 songs constructed from the rhythms and pitches of human speech as found on answering machine messages. The notes and rhythms of the messages are painstakingly figured out, and songs are built around the resultant melodies. The Sursiks are a REAL band of REAL people, playing REAL instruments. The Sursiks 2nd cd (released March 28 2007), "Lydia Grace" is a collection of 13 songs written and sung by a 3 year old girl. The Sursiks 3rd cd is entitled "Christmas in March". The release date December 15th 2008. "Christmas in March" is 50+ seamless minutes of music "sung" by voices from television, radio and various other sources. Commercials, news reports, self-help tapes, religious programs, pop radio-dj banter, and a host of other recordings are mixed up and set to music, in order to create extremely funny new perceptions of our media environment. The Sursiks' musical arrangements on this recording include the usual rock instruments plus a wide variety of percussion instruments, flute, saxes, trumpets and violins.
